Are Sydney fireworks televised?

Centring on the Sydney Harbour Bridge and surrounding Port Jackson, its main events are two pyrotechnic displays: the 9 pm Family Fireworks and the Midnight Fireworks, both of which are televised nationally with the more popular Midnight Fireworks televised globally.

Where is the best view of Sydney fireworks?

North. North of the harbour, there are some ripper vantage points to see the city fireworks: Blues Point Reserve, McMahons Point, free, opens 8am. Bradfield Park & Mary Booth Reserve, Milsons Point, free, opens 8am.

How much do the Sydney New Year fireworks cost?

The Sydney New Year’s Eve Party is one of the largest and most advanced fireworks display anywhere on earth, spend a budget of $7 million on eight tonnes of fireworks.
